Workmen’s Compensation Insurance

 

workmen

The Workmen’s Compensation Insurance is a compulsory Insurance which employers in Singapore are required to purchase according to the Workmen’s Compensation Act 1998.

It is an offence for employers no to provide their workmen with the Insurance Cover. Penalty is a fine of up to $10,000, jail term of up to 1-year or both.

 

What is considered a “Workman”?

- A Person engaged in manual labour regardless of how much he earns

- A Person engaged in non-manual labour where his average monthly salary does not exceed $1,600

 

Coverage:

1] Medical Expense Benefit

2] Temporary Incapacity Benefit

3] Permanent Incapacity Benefit

4] Dependent’s death benefit
